The ICSE (Indian Certificate of Secondary Education) board is governed by the Council for the Indian School Certificate Examinations (CISCE), headquartered in New Delhi. Known for its rigorous and comprehensive English-medium curriculum, CISCE is among India's most respected private school boards. Class 3 falls under the primary school stage, catering to children aged 8 to 9 years, and lays the foundation for conceptual learning across all subjects.
The ICSE Class 3 curriculum is designed to nurture curiosity, language skills, logical thinking, and scientific awareness in young learners. It balances academic depth with age-appropriate content, making it one of the most structured primary curricula available in Indian schools today.
The ICSE Class 3 syllabus covers a well-rounded mix of languages, sciences, mathematics, and social awareness. Here is a quick overview of all core subjects:
| Subject | Key Focus Areas |
|---|---|
| English | Reading comprehension, writing, grammar, vocabulary, spelling |
| Mathematics | Number systems, operations, shapes, measurements, data handling |
| Science / EVS | Plants, animals, water, air, environment, living and non-living things |
| Social Studies | Community, geography, history, civic life |
| Hindi | Reading, writing, comprehension in Hindi |
| Computer Studies | Basic computer concepts, digital literacy |

Mathematics at Class 3 ICSE level builds strong number sense and arithmetic skills. Key topics include addition and subtraction with carrying, multiplication, basic division, fractions, shapes, and simple measurements. Mastering multiplication tables from 2 to 20 is a critical benchmark for every Class 3 student.

Olympiad exams are an excellent opportunity for Class 3 students to test their knowledge beyond the regular syllabus. Bodies like the Science Olympiad Foundation (SOF), Silverzone Foundation, and Unified Council conduct Olympiads in Maths (IMO), Science (NSO), English (IEO), and GK (IGKO) for primary school students.
